What is the expected phenotypic ratio for feather colour if two chickens with blue feathers are crossed
ss7ja [257]

Answer:

The correct answer is - 1:2:1 for black : blue : white chicken.

Explanation:

We know that color of the feather is a trait of the chicken that shows the codominance type of inheritance pattern where both forms of the trait are dominant and make a mix of the forms. In this case, blue is heterozygous BW and black BB and white is WW, then crossed between BW with BW

gametes: B, W and B, W

Punnett

           B       W

B        BB      BW

W        BW     WW

thus, the phenotypic ration is - 1 black : 2 blue : 1 white

What kind of relationship does the manta ray happen to have with the sturgeon fish ?
grigory [225]

Answer:

Symbiotic relationship

Explanation:

The relationship between the manta ray and the sturgeon fish is a symbiotic relationship. It is also known as mutualism. It involves two organisms benefiting from each other. The two creatures gain something from each other.

The manta ray is cleansed of the dead skin cells and parasites by the sturgeon fish while Sturgeon fish gains a food source from the the manta ray.

How does selective breeding affect natural selection?
vichka [17]

Answer:

Natural selection and selective breeding can both cause changes in animals and plants. The difference between the two is that natural selection happens naturally, but selective breeding only occurs when humans intervene. For this reason selective breeding is sometimes called artificial selection.
